Implementing governance frameworks and data catalogs to manage NoSQL schema ownership and lineage.
An evergreen guide detailing practical strategies for governing NoSQL schema ownership, establishing data catalogs, and tracing lineage to ensure consistency, security, and value across modern distributed data systems.
August 04, 2025
Facebook X Reddit
NoSQL ecosystems have grown rapidly, embracing flexible schemas and scalable storage across diverse platforms. Governance in this context means more than policy documents; it requires a practical framework that aligns people, processes, and technology. A robust approach begins with clear ownership: who is responsible for schema decisions, data models, and evolution rules? Without defined accountability, teams may duplicate efforts, overlook compatibility concerns, or drift away from strategic data principles. Establishing governance begins with mapping critical data domains, identifying steward roles, and outlining decision rights. This foundation enables controlled experimentation, reduces technical debt, and fosters a culture where data quality is a shared obligation rather than a localized initiative tied to a single team.
Complementing ownership structures, data catalogs provide discoverability, context, and lineage visibility that makes governance tangible. In NoSQL environments, catalogs must accommodate dynamic schemas, polyglot storage, and evolving access patterns. A practical catalog integrates metadata about data sources, data producers, and consumers, along with quality metrics and change histories. It should also offer lightweight lineage tracing to show how data transforms as it moves through pipelines, even when schema elements are flexible. By enabling search, tagging, and relationship mapping, catalogs empower engineers, data scientists, and operators to understand data provenance, assess impact of changes, and collaborate without constant cross-team handoffs.
Practical steps to implement cataloging and lineage in NoSQL contexts.
Designing governance for NoSQL requires articulating a lifecycle for schemas and data structures. Start with a lightweight policy that covers naming conventions, data type expectations, and validation hooks, then progressively enrich it with constraints suitable for your workload. Emphasize backward compatibility and deprecation strategies so that systems can evolve without breaking dependent services. Integrate governance into CI/CD pipelines by validating schema changes during pull requests, recording rationale, and linking changes to business objectives. A well-defined lifecycle reduces surprise changes, supports incident response, and provides a repeatable blueprint for teams adopting new NoSQL technologies or expanding existing deployments.
ADVERTISEMENT
ADVERTISEMENT
Beyond policies, governance must be pragmatic, scalable, and observable. Implement role-based access controls that align with data sensitivity and operational responsibilities, ensuring that schema changes go through appropriate reviews. Build dashboards that surface key indicators, such as schema drift, change frequency, and owner activity. These insights help teams anticipate risks, prioritize remediation, and maintain a stable data platform. Importantly, integrate governance with incident management so that any disruption tied to schema changes is traceable to its origin and resolved with minimal downstream impact. This observability layer turns abstract governance concepts into measurable, actionable outcomes.
Defining ownership, stewardship, and accountability across data assets.
A practical NoSQL catalog begins with standardized metadata schemas that accommodate flexible structures. Capture essential attributes such as source system, data producer, subject area, retention policy, access control, and quality indicators. Tie each data asset to a steward who can answer questions about provenance and intent. Use lightweight, schema-agnostic tagging to describe data characteristics without forcing rigid schemas. Complement tags with automated lineage signals where possible, such as data ingestion timestamps, transformation notes, and lineage arrows that indicate upstream and downstream relationships. A catalog built on this foundation becomes a living map of data assets, enabling informed governance decisions.
ADVERTISEMENT
ADVERTISEMENT
Automation plays a central role in keeping catalogs accurate. Leverage data ingestion events, change data capture, and observability signals to populate and refresh metadata in near real time. Create pipelines that enrich catalog entries with observations from monitoring systems, data quality checks, and access logs. Implement reconciliation processes that detect missing or conflicting metadata and raise alerts for owners to resolve. By automating metadata capture and reconciliation, you reduce manual burden, improve reliability, and ensure that the catalog remains a trustworthy source of truth for governance decisions.
Techniques to monitor lineage and assess impact of changes.
Stewardship in NoSQL requires explicit roles that map to domains, data products, and lifecycle events. Define data stewards who are accountable for accuracy, classification, and retention of their domains. Assign data custodians who handle operational aspects such as access control, performance, and encryption considerations. Establish escalation paths for governance questions and conflicts, so that decisions do not stall projects. In distributed environments, align stewardship with cross-functional teams, including security, compliance, and product engineering. Clear accountability reduces ambiguity, accelerates decision-making, and builds trust in the governance framework across the organization.
Accountability emerges when governance metrics are integrated into performance discussions and planning rituals. Track metrics such as schema drift rate, time-to-approve changes, and compliance with retention policies. Tie these metrics to incentives and career development so teams see tangible benefits from participating in governance. Regular governance reviews create opportunities to reflect on lessons learned, adjust ownership allocations, and refine processes. This disciplined cadence ensures that governance remains relevant as data landscapes evolve, rather than becoming a static artifact that teams bypass in favor of expediency.
ADVERTISEMENT
ADVERTISEMENT
Real-world patterns for sustaining NoSQL governance and catalog health.
Lineage in NoSQL contexts often requires pragmatic, tool-supported approaches. Capture lineage at logical boundaries like collection-level relationships, transformation steps, and key join points across data domains. Even without rigid schemas, you can model lineage by documenting data provenance, provenance methods, and responsible owners for each stage. Visualizations that illustrate upstream sources, transformation rules, and downstream consumers help teams appreciate the full impact of changes. When changes occur, lineage reviews should accompany them to evaluate downstream compatibility, data quality implications, and potential security considerations. A robust lineage practice reduces surprise failures and promotes confidence in data-driven decisions.
Integrate lineage with change management to close the loop between governance and delivery. Require that any schema evolution, index adjustment, or data model refactoring passes through a lineage-aware approval workflow. In NoSQL environments, where formats adapt quickly, it is critical to capture the intent behind changes and their expected effects on downstream products. Link each change to business outcomes, risk assessments, and regulatory considerations. This integrated approach helps teams balance agility with controls, ensuring that rapid experimentation does not undermine governance objectives.
Real-world governance succeeds when organizations treat it as an evolving practice rather than a rigid ceremony. Start with a minimal, well-communicated policy set, then expand based on feedback and measurable outcomes. Invest in training to help engineers interpret catalog metadata and understand lineage signals. Encourage communities of practice where teams share templates, common patterns, and lessons learned. Maintain lightweight governance artifacts that are easy to maintain and integrate into daily workflows. Over time, the combination of clear ownership, automated catalogs, and visible lineage creates a resilient foundation that scales with data growth.
In the long run, the payoff is a data-enabled culture grounded in trust, transparency, and collaboration. When NoSQL governance and catalogs are well designed, teams move faster without sacrificing quality or compliance. Data products become discoverable, auditable, and reusable, empowering experimentation and informed decision-making. Organizations that invest in governance as a shared capability reap benefits in security, reliability, and business value. By continuously refining ownership models, catalog schemas, and lineage practices, enterprises can capture the full potential of their NoSQL ecosystems while preserving the flexibility that makes them powerful.
Related Articles
This evergreen guide explains how to design, implement, and enforce role-based access control and precise data permissions within NoSQL ecosystems, balancing developer agility with strong security, auditing, and compliance across modern deployments.
July 23, 2025
Designing resilient incremental search indexes and synchronization workflows from NoSQL change streams requires a practical blend of streaming architectures, consistent indexing strategies, fault tolerance, and clear operational boundaries.
July 30, 2025
Successful evolution of NoSQL schemas across interconnected microservices demands coordinated governance, versioned migrations, backward compatibility, and robust testing to prevent cascading failures and data integrity issues.
August 09, 2025
A practical guide to building layered validation that prevents dangerous NoSQL schema changes from slipping through, ensuring code review and continuous integration enforce safe, auditable, and reversible modifications.
August 07, 2025
In complex microservice ecosystems, schema drift in NoSQL databases emerges as services evolve independently. This evergreen guide outlines pragmatic, durable strategies to align data models, reduce coupling, and preserve operational resiliency without stifling innovation.
July 18, 2025
This evergreen guide explores durable approaches to map multi-level permissions, ownership transitions, and delegation flows within NoSQL databases, emphasizing scalable schemas, clarity, and secure access control patterns.
August 07, 2025
Establishing reliable automated alerts for NoSQL systems requires clear anomaly definitions, scalable monitoring, and contextual insights into write amplification and compaction patterns, enabling proactive performance tuning and rapid incident response.
July 29, 2025
Thoughtful default expiration policies can dramatically reduce storage costs, improve performance, and preserve data relevance by aligning retention with data type, usage patterns, and compliance needs across distributed NoSQL systems.
July 17, 2025
Designing robust per-collection lifecycle policies in NoSQL databases ensures timely data decay, secure archival storage, and auditable deletion processes, balancing compliance needs with operational efficiency and data retrieval requirements.
July 23, 2025
This evergreen guide explores layered observability, integrating application traces with NoSQL client and server metrics, to enable precise, end-to-end visibility, faster diagnostics, and proactive system tuning across distributed data services.
July 31, 2025
This evergreen guide explores resilient strategies for multi-stage reindexing and index promotion in NoSQL systems, ensuring uninterrupted responsiveness while maintaining data integrity, consistency, and performance across evolving schemas.
July 19, 2025
Managing massive NoSQL migrations demands synchronized planning, safe cutovers, and resilient rollback strategies. This evergreen guide surveys practical approaches to re-shard partitions across distributed stores while minimizing downtime, preventing data loss, and preserving service quality. It emphasizes governance, automation, testing, and observability to keep teams aligned during complex re-partitioning initiatives, ensuring continuity and steady progress.
August 09, 2025
This evergreen guide explores NoSQL log modeling patterns that enhance forensic analysis, regulatory compliance, data integrity, and scalable auditing across distributed systems and microservice architectures.
July 19, 2025
NoSQL systems face spikes from hotkeys; this guide explains hedging, strategic retries, and adaptive throttling to stabilize latency, protect throughput, and maintain user experience during peak demand and intermittent failures.
July 21, 2025
In today’s multi-tenant NoSQL environments, effective tenant-aware routing and strategic sharding are essential to guarantee isolation, performance, and predictable scalability while preserving security boundaries across disparate workloads.
August 02, 2025
This evergreen guide explores practical strategies for designing scalable billing and metering ledgers in NoSQL, emphasizing idempotent event processing, robust reconciliation, and durable ledger semantics across distributed systems.
August 09, 2025
Effective cardinality estimation enables NoSQL planners to allocate resources precisely, optimize index usage, and accelerate query execution by predicting selective filters, joins, and aggregates with high confidence across evolving data workloads.
July 18, 2025
When onboarding tenants into a NoSQL system, structure migration planning around disciplined schema hygiene, scalable growth, and transparent governance to minimize risk, ensure consistency, and promote sustainable performance across evolving data ecosystems.
July 16, 2025
This evergreen guide explores durable patterns for structuring NoSQL documents to minimize cross-collection reads, improve latency, and maintain data integrity by bundling related entities into cohesive, self-contained documents.
August 08, 2025
In dynamic distributed databases, crafting robust emergency evacuation plans requires rigorous design, simulated failure testing, and continuous verification to ensure data integrity, consistent state, and rapid recovery without service disruption.
July 15, 2025